AKANEIRO #2 (of 3)

Justin Aclin (W), Vasilis Lolos (A), Michael Atiyeh (C), and Shu Yan (Cover)

On sale June 26
FC, 32 pages
$3.99
Miniseries

American McGee’s reenvisioning of Red Riding Hood takes shape as this all-new story.

The brave young warrior Kani battles a gauntlet of fantastic mythical beasts inspired by Japanese folklore. However, things are not what they seem, and danger lurks where Kani least expects it!

Justin Aclin (Star Wars: The Clone Wars) and Vasilis Lolos (Conan the Barbarian)!

AMALA’S BLADE #3 (of 4)

Steve Horton (W) and Michael Dialynas (A/C/Cover)

On sale June 26
FC, 32 pages
$3.50
Miniseries

Master assassin Amala makes a startling discovery about her latest target that will change her life forever! And Amala’s day turns full of surprises when she’s thrown into an abandoned subway to face a Modifier monstrosity!

BUFFY THE VAMPIRE SLAYER SEASON 9 #22

Andrew Chambliss (W), Georges Jeanty (A/Variant cover), Dexter Vines (I), Michelle Madsen (C), and Phil Noto (Cover),

On sale June 12
FC, 32 pages
$2.99
Ongoing

Buffy, Xander, and Willow must fight against all odds to get past the mystical council and gain entry to a magical hotspot—the Deeper Well! New allies are born while old enemies bring the heat. Grave dangers await our heroes at the center of the earth!

BUFFY THE VAMPIRE SLAYER: WILLOW—WONDERLAND TP

Jeff Parker (W), Christos Gage (W), Brian Ching (P), Jason Gorder (I), Michelle Madsen (C), and David Mack (Cover)

On sale Sept 3
FC, 144 pages
$17.99
TP, 7″ x 10″

Armed with Buffy’s broken scythe, Willow has entered another dimension and begun a quest to somehow, someway, against all odds, bring magic back to Earth. She must keep her darkest self at bay while she battles demons—the scaly and horned type as well as her own! Collects the five-issue miniseries.

Season 9 continues with Willow’s story!

EMPOWERED SPECIAL #4: ANIMAL STYLE

Adam Warren (W/P/Cover), John Staton (A/Cover), and Robaato (C)

On sale June 5
b&w, 32 pages
$3.99
One-shot

TERRORPIN! POWERPACHYDERM! BRASS MONKEY! CYBERIAN TIGER! SUPERCOBRA! MAUL BUNNY! Can struggling superheroine Empowered foil a mass carjacking by these animal-armored crimebots at the 21st annual Alternate Timeline Superhero Auto Show? Can one exceedingly flimsy “supersuit” overcome fourteen hostile tons of heavy metal? This action-packed new Empowered one-shot says: “MAYBE!”

• 30 brand new story pages, with art by mecha-master John Staton and major-color-domo Robaato, plus bonus art by Adam Warren!
